材質筆刷

Revit 元素材質批量塗抹工具

功能概述

材質筆刷工具提供快速批量塗抹與管理 Revit 元素表面材質的功能。相比於手動逐一選取元素並修改材質,本工具支援依元素類別、手動挑選或大面積自動填充等多種方式,大幅提高材質配置效率。

系統可根據設定的階段與樓層篩選範圍,並支援材質關鍵字搜尋與材質對映功能,滿足複雜專案的材質管理需求。所有作業均在您目前開啟的 Revit 檔案中直接執行,無需額外匯入或匯出任何設定。

使用情境

情境一:結構元素材質批量塗抹

為所有混凝土柱、樑統一設定相同材質,或區分不同階段的結構材質。使用「依元素」模式可快速套用至指定類別的所有元素。

情境二:局部區域材質調整

針對特定元素或其特定面(如牆面的某一側)進行材質修改。使用「依挑選」模式可精確控制塗抹範圍。

情境三:一般模型大面積填充

為大量一般模型(GM,如家具、設備)自動套用材質。使用「大面積部份填充」模式可根據面積閾值與材質對映規則批量處理,也可手動輸入元素編號逐一指定。

三種作業模式

依元素

根據元素類別(如牆、樓板、柱、樑)批量塗抹材質,可設定方向(上/下/周區)與篩選條件。

依挑選

手動在 Revit 視圖中挑選特定元素或面進行材質塗抹,適合局部精細調整。

大面積部份填充

針對一般模型(GM)進行批量材質填充,支援材質對映、面積閾值篩選與手動編號輸入等多種方式。

通用設定(所有模式共用)

步驟一:選擇階段與樓層

在視窗左側的「階段」與「樓層」清單中勾選需要處理的範圍。系統將只影響符合這些篩選條件的元素,未勾選的階段或樓層不會受到任何影響。

💡 小技巧

善用階段與樓層篩選可避免誤操作到不需要處理的區域,建議在執行前務必確認範圍正確。

步驟二:選擇表面材質

在右側「表面材質」清單中選擇要套用的材質。如果專案中的材質數量較多,可透過上方的搜尋欄位輸入關鍵字快速過濾,例如輸入「混凝土」即可列出所有含有該字眼的材質。

💡 快速指定材質

在材質清單上按右鍵,可以選擇「指定左」或「指定右」,將當前選擇的材質自動填入大面積填充模式中的對應欄位。

模式一:依元素塗抹材質

加入目標元素類別

視窗左方的「元素類」清單會顯示目前檔案中所有可用的元素型式,包括:

  • [Floor]:樓板的型式列表
  • [Wall]:牆體的型式列表(不包含幕牆)
  • [Framing]:結構樑的型式列表
  • [Column]:結構柱的型式列表

操作方式:

  • 在「元素類」清單中勾選一個或多個類型,點擊「-->」按鈕加入至右方「應用元素」清單
  • 或在「元素類」清單按右鍵選擇「挑選」,直接在 Revit 視圖中點選元素,系統會自動將其型式移至「應用元素」清單
  • 已加入的項目可透過勾選後點擊「<--」移除,或點擊「重設」清空所有設定重新開始

設定塗抹方向(適用於樓板、牆體等元素)

在右下角「方向」區域可選擇要塗抹的面向:

  • :只塗抹元素的上表面(如樓板的頂面)
  • :只塗抹元素的下表面(如樓板的底面,預設選項)
  • 周區:只塗抹元素的垂直側面(如牆體的四個立面)

💡 說明

預設選擇「下」,若不需特別指定可保持這個設定。系統會自動根據元素幾何判斷哪些面符合您選擇的方向。

⚠️ 幕牆排除

「依元素」模式中不會包含幕牆類型,這是因為幕牆的材質結構與一般牆體不同,需另行處理。

模式二:依挑選塗抹材質

此模式適合需要精確指定塗抹面的情況,操作分為兩個步驟:

  1. 點擊「挑選元素」按鈕,在 Revit 視圖中選取一個實體元素(系統會顯示其編號)。
  2. 點擊「挑選面並上色」按鈕,在該元素的幾何體上點選您想要塗抹的特定面。點選後系統會自動將材質套用至該面及具有相同朝向的所有面。

⚠️ 注意事項

請先完成「挑選元素」再進行「挑選面並上色」,否則系統無法正確判斷要處理的對象。

模式三:大面積部份填充

材質對映規則(可選)

若您需要將現有材質批次換成另一種材質,可建立材質對映規則:

  1. 在「材質」下拉選單中選擇原始材質(留空表示不限制)。
  2. 在「表面材質」下拉選單中選擇要替換成的目標材質。
  3. 點擊「新增對映」將規則加入清單,可建立多條規則一次執行。
  4. 已建立的規則可點取清單最右側的刪除按鈕移除。

啟用材質對映後,系統只會處理符合原始材質的面,並自動替換為對應的目標材質。若不想使用對映功能,可勾選「不使用對映」以跳過此步驟。

設定面積閾值

輸入「面積小於」的數值(單位:平方公尺),小於此面積的表面將不會被塗抹。預設值為 0.25 平方公尺,可避免細小的邊緣或裝飾面被過度處理。

💡 快速設定面積

點擊「挑面」按鈕後在一般模型上選取一個面,系統會自動以該面的面積作為閾值設定值,方便您依實際需求快速調整。

手動輸入元素編號(可選)

若您已知需要處理的特定元素,可在文字欄位中輸入元素編號,多個編號之間以逗號分隔。輸入完成後點擊「手動輸入ID」即可對這些指定元素進行材質填充。

一般模型操作(可選)

點擊「挑選一般模型」按鈕,在 Revit 視圖中點選一個一般模型物件,系統會對其所有符合面積條件的表面進行塗抹。

進階選項

  • 清除材質:勾選後在塗抹前會先清除該面上的既有材質,確保新材質完全覆蓋舊材質。
  • 不偵測是否與樑接觸:勾選後系統將跳過與結構樑的碰撞檢查,可加快處理速度。但若元素緊鄰樑體,此操作可能會導致不預期的塗抹結果。

設定檔管理

您可將目前的對映規則、面積閾值等設定儲存為檔案,方便日後在相同專案中重複使用:

  • Load:載入先前儲存的設定檔。
  • Save:覆蓋儲存目前設定至現有檔案。

清除材質

若需要移除已塗抹的材質:

  1. 在對應模式中設定篩選條件(類別、階段、樓層等)。
  2. 點擊「清除材質」按鈕。
  3. 系統會將符合條件的元素材質面重置,恢復為預設狀態。

操作步驟

模式一:依元素塗抹材質

  1. 切換至「依元素」分頁。
  2. 在左側勾選目標階段與樓層。
  3. 將需要的元素型式從「元素類」移至「應用元素」清單(可透過手動選擇或「挑選」按鈕)。
  4. 點擊「-->」按鈕加入,或按右鍵「挑選」直接在 Revit 中選取。
  5. 在右側「表面材質」清單中選擇要套用的材質。
  6. 在「方向」區域選擇塗抹面向(上/下/周區),預設為「下」。
  7. 點擊「上材質」按鈕執行塗抹。
  8. 系統會在下方訊息區顯示處理過程與結果。

模式二:依挑選塗抹材質

  1. 切換至「依挑選」分頁。
  2. 在右側「表面材質」清單中選擇要套用的材質。
  3. 點擊「挑選元素」按鈕,在 Revit 視圖中點選需要處理的物件。
  4. 點擊「挑選面並上色」按鈕,在該物件上選取要塗抹的面。
  5. 系統會自動將材質套用至所選朝向的所有對應面。

模式三:大面積填充

  1. 切換至「大面積部份填充」分頁。
  2. (可選)建立材質對映規則,設定 From → To 的材質替換對應。
  3. 設定「面積小於」閾值,避免細小面被誤塗。
  4. 勾選進階選項(如需要清除既有材質或跳過樑碰撞檢查)。
  5. 選擇以下其中一種方式執行:
    • 挑選一般模型:點擊按鈕後在 Revit 視圖中點選一個一般模型物件,系統會對其所有符合面積條件的表面進行塗抹。
    • 手動輸入 ID:於文字欄位中輸入元素編號(多個編號以逗號分隔),點擊「手動輸入ID」執行塗抹。
    • 挑面:在一般模型上選取一個面,系統會自動以該面的面積作為閾值設定。

⚠️ 注意事項

  • 不可逆操作:材質塗抹與清除後無法在工具內還原,建議先在副本檔案測試以確認結果符合預期。
  • 方向設定:針對樓板、屋頂等元素,方向設定會影響塗抹的面,請務必確認選擇正確(上/下/周區)。
  • 面積閾值:設定的數值越低,被處理的表面越多。若將閾值設為接近零,可能會導致大量細小面被處理,增加執行時間。
  • 僅限平面模型文件:本工具無法在族編輯器(Family Document)中使用,請確認您正在操作的是專案文件(Project File)。

🔒 操作安全提醒

材質筆刷工具會直接修改 Revit 檔案中的材質資料。雖然系統已加入錯誤處理機制,但若遇到不預期的狀況可能無法復原。強烈建議在執行大批量作業前,先備份您的 Revit 檔案或在小範圍測試確認無誤後再全面執行。

使用技巧與注意事項

✓ 高效作業建議

  • 材質對映批量處理:可建立多條 From → To 對映規則,一次執行即可完成複雜的材質替換作業。
  • 關鍵字搜尋:在「表面材質」上方的搜尋欄位中輸入關鍵字,即可快速過濾並找到目標材質。
  • 階段篩選:善用階段與樓層篩選可避免誤操作到不需要處理的區域。
  • 設定檔保存:若經常使用相同的對映規則與參數設定,可使用 Load / Save 功能保存設定,下次直接載入即可。

⚠️ 重要注意事項

  • 塗抹方向會影響結果:針對樓板等元素,選擇「上」、「下」或「周區」會導致不同表面被修改,請務必確認。
  • 幕牆無法處理:幕牆材質需另外手動調整,本工具的「依元素」模式不會包含幕牆類型。
  • 清除材質不可撤銷:一旦執行清除操作無法在工具內還原,請謹慎使用。